Jackson's accusations span 25 years and multiple trials, cases, and documentaries. The first being an investigation in August of 1993, with the latest being March 2019 with "Leaving Neverland", a documentary that re sparked old allegations from Wade Robson and James Safechuck.

But let's get into Robson and Safechuck, the two main accusers throughout Jackson's allegations.
Let's start with Robson, who met Jackson for winning a dance competition in 1987. He visited Jackson in Neverland 4 times over 7 years after his mother made half the family move from Australia to California, expecting to live on Neverland after winning the competition.
They said they were invited, but Jackson didn't buy the property until 1988 and he didn't start actually using it until 1989. This doesn't seem to add up unless he knew that he was going to have this property for sure a year prior.
In 2012 he said that the abuse from Jackson was constant and happened daily, which is impossible since he only saw Jackson a relatively few times over the years prior to the accusations. But this is one thing we need to know about Robson, he is very inconsistent.
He went from "I suppressed the memories" to "I remembered but knew it wasn't right" to "Jackson threatened my family to stay quiet". Actually, there was a time in court where he said that Jackson actually never sexually abused him at all! (hard to see but it's all there)

On to Safechuck. He met Jackson after starring in a Pepsi commercial with him.
Safechuck defended Jackson on two different occasions, then comes forward in 2014, saying Jackson abused him over a hundred times over a four year period, beginning when he was four.

Now there isn't too muchelse to say on Safechuck, other than his explanation on how Jackson abused him vastly contradict Robson's ("Safechuck painted Jackson as a careful and conscious abuser, while Robson portrayed him as restless and predatory")
Both Safechuck and Robson say they aren't in it for the money, but, Robson looked around for amultimillion dollar book deal months before going public,Robson opened a "survivors charity", and both men sued the Jackson estate for a cash settlement.

There are many other trials involving people such as Gavin Arvizo, Jordan Chandler (where Jackson was forced to be strip searched, and have photos taken of every part of his lower body), and many others. All these with extensive witnesses and evidence, end acquitted or settled.
